对于Windows 10用户而言,安装虚拟机运行Ubuntu不仅能够拓宽你的技术视野,还能让你在无需重启的情况下体验Linux系统的强大功能和灵活性
本文将详细指导你如何在Windows 10上安装虚拟机并运行Ubuntu,让你轻松迈入双系统操作的便捷之门
一、虚拟机简介及其优势 虚拟机(Virtual Machine, VM)是一种通过软件模拟的完整计算机系统
它允许你在现有的操作系统(如Windows 10)上运行另一个操作系统(如Ubuntu),而无需在硬件上进行物理分区或双启动
虚拟机的核心优势包括: 1.资源隔离:虚拟机在逻辑上与主机系统隔离,确保两者运行互不干扰
2.便捷性:无需重启即可在多个操作系统间切换,极大提高了工作效率
3.安全性:在虚拟机中测试软件或进行实验,可以有效避免对主机系统造成潜在损害
4.成本效益:无需额外购买硬件即可体验多种操作系统
二、选择虚拟机软件 市面上有多个流行的虚拟机软件可供选择,其中VMware Workstation和Oracle VirtualBox因其易用性和强大功能而广受好评
对于初学者而言,Oracle VirtualBox因其免费开源、安装简单、兼容性好等特点,是更为理想的选择
本文将基于Oracle VirtualBox进行说明
三、准备工作 在开始安装之前,请确保你的Windows 10系统满足以下基本要求: - 硬件要求:至少4GB RAM,建议8GB以上;至少20GB的可用磁盘空间;支持虚拟化技术的CPU(大多数现代处理器都支持)
- 软件要求:下载并安装最新版本的Oracle VirtualBox;下载Ubuntu ISO镜像文件(根据你的需求选择LTS长期支持版本或最新版本)
四、安装Oracle VirtualBox 1.下载Oracle VirtualBox:访问Oracle VirtualBox官方网站,根据你的操作系统类型(32位或64位)下载对应的安装包
2.安装:双击下载的安装包,按照提示完成安装过程
安装过程中可能会要求你安装一些必要的组件或驱动程序,请按照提示操作
五、创建虚拟机 1.启动Oracle VirtualBox:安装完成后,打开Oracle VirtualBox管理器
2.新建虚拟机:点击左上角的“新建”按钮,开始创建新的虚拟机
3.配置虚拟机名称和操作系统类型:为你的虚拟机命名,并选择操作系统类型为“Linux”和版本为“Ubuntu”(根据下载的ISO镜像版本选择)
4.分配内存:根据你的系统资源情况,为虚拟机分配内存
建议至少分配2GB RAM,以保证Ubuntu系统的流畅运行
5.创建虚拟硬盘:选择“现在创建虚拟硬盘”,然后点击“创建”
6.选择硬盘文件类型:默认选择VDI(VirtualBox磁盘映像),点击“下一步”
7.选择存储方式:对于大多数用户来说,“动态分配”是一个不错的选择,因为它会根据虚拟机实际使用的空间动态增长,节省磁盘空间
8.设置硬盘大小:建议至少分配20GB空间,以满足Ubuntu系统的基本需求
六、安装Ubuntu 1.挂载ISO镜像:在虚拟机设置中,找到“存储”选项卡,点击“控制器:IDE”下的“空的光盘驱动器”,然后选择“选择一个磁盘文件”,浏览并选择你之前下载的Ubuntu ISO镜像文件
2.启动虚拟机:选中你创建的Ubuntu虚拟机,点击“启动”
3.安装Ubuntu:虚拟机启动后,你将看到Ubuntu的安装界面
按照屏幕提示,选择语言、键盘布局、安装类型(推荐选择“清除整个磁盘并安装Ubuntu”以简化安装过程,但请确保虚拟机专属硬盘不会被误删)、设置时区、创建用户账户等
4.重启虚拟机:安装完成后,虚拟机会提示重启
此时,你可以移除ISO镜像挂载(在虚拟机设置中取消勾选ISO文件),然后重启虚拟机,以正常启动Ubuntu系统
七、优化虚拟机设置 1.安装VBoxGuestAdditions:为了让Ubuntu在VirtualBox中运行更加流畅,尤其是实现全屏显示、共享文件夹等功能,你需要安装VBoxGuestAdditions
在Ubuntu中,打开终端,输入以下命令: bash sudo apt update sudo apt install virtualbox-guest-utils virtualbox-guest-x11 然后,在VirtualBox的菜单栏中选择“设备”->“安装增强功能”,按照提示完成安装
2.设置共享文件夹:在VirtualBox管理器中,为你的虚拟机设置共享文件夹,这样你可以在Ubuntu中轻松访问Windows 10系统上的文件
设置完成后,在Ubuntu中挂载共享文件夹即可
八、探索Ubuntu世界 现在,你已经成功在Windows 10上安装了虚拟机并运行Ubuntu
Ubuntu以其强大的命令行工具、丰富的开源软件库、直观的用户界面以及强大的安全性,为你提供了无限的学习和开发潜力
你可以尝试安装各种服务器软件、编程环境、图形设计工具等,尽情探索Linux世界的魅力
九、结语 通过本文的指导,你不仅学会了如何在Windows 10上安装虚拟机并运行Ubuntu,还掌握了虚拟机的基本配置和优化技巧
这一技能不仅能够帮助你拓宽技术视野,提升工作效率,还能让你在享受Windows系统便利性的同时,体验到Linux系统的独特魅力
随着你对Ubuntu的深入探索,相信你会发现更多关于操作系统、软件开发、网络安全等方面的有趣知识
开启你的多元操作系统之旅,享受技术带来的无限乐趣吧!
虚拟机Win系统无法显示解决指南
Win10下轻松安装Ubuntu虚拟机
云电脑软件菜鸡:游戏新体验,轻松畅玩
iOS设备安装Windows虚拟机失败:问题排查与解决方案
“云手机搭建:电脑配置需求详解”
云上开庭软件:一键下载开启在线庭审
Win10自带虚拟机传文件夹教程
Win10自带虚拟机传文件夹教程
Win10系统虚拟机安装超详细教程
虚拟机Win10主板安装全攻略
VMware虚拟机中Win10系统联网设置全攻略
Win10虚拟机v1909死机解决方案
Win10 iOS镜像,虚拟机高效下载指南
Win10虚拟机平台:提升效率的多任务神器
Win10虚拟机网络连接设置全攻略:轻松配置,畅享网络
虚拟机V7升级Win10教程来袭
Win10自带虚拟机开启实用指南
VM虚拟机轻松安装Windows系统
Win10系统下安装虚拟机XP卡顿问题全解析